PLC脉冲信号是干嘛的?与频率,占空比,正、负逻辑有什么关系?
在数字电子系统中,所有传送的信号均为开关量,即只有两种状态的电信号,这种电信号,我们称作做脉冲信号,这是所有数字电路中的基本电信号
一个标准的脉冲信号如下图所示。
我们把脉冲信号由低电压跳变至高电压的脉冲信号边沿称做上升沿,把由高电压跳边至低电压的边沿称下降沿,有的资料上又叫前沿,后沿。把电压低的称做低电平 ,电压高的称做高电平 。
假设脉冲信号的周期为T ,脉冲宽变为t1 则有下面一些基本概念。
频率f: 指一秒种内脉冲信号周期变化的次数,即f = 1 / T周期越小,频率越大。
有了频率这个概念,我们现在就来讨论一下从PLC输入端输入开关信号的最高频率问题。由上一章扫描及PLC的滞后知识可知,PLC的扫描周期主要由用户程序的长短所决定,假定其扫描周期为20ms,并考虑到输入滤波器的响应延迟为10ms,则PLC执行扫描周期为30ms。如果输入信号的变化小于30ms的话由扫描原理可知,PLC完全可能检测不到,也就是说输入信号的脉宽一定要大于30ms,这样,输入信号的频率就受到了限制。
我们假定输入信号是占空比为50%的脉冲信号,则其周期为T=2t1=60ms那么输入信号的频率不能大于1/60ms=16.6HZ。这对于按钮,普通开关等一般工业控制场合是完全可以的,但对于要求I/O响应速度高的实时控制场合就不能适应了。
对于要求高速响应的场合,不同厂家的PLC都在软件和硬件上采取了很多措施,提高I/O的响应速度。FX2N设计了高速计数模块,提供了X0~X7共8个高速输入端,,其RC滤波器的时间仅为0.5us在软件方面采用I/O即时信息刷新方式,中断传送方式和能用指令修改的数字式滤波器等。因此可以处理的输入信号频率有了很大提高,可以达到20KHZ。
占空比: 指脉冲宽度t1与周期T的比例百分比。为t1/T %。占空比的含义是脉冲所占据周期的空间,占空比越大,表示脉冲宽度越接近周期T,也表示脉冲信号的平均值越大。
正逻辑与负逻辑: 脉冲信号只有两种状态:高电平和低电平,与数字电路的二种逻辑状态“1”和“0”相对应,但到底是高电平表示“1”还是低电平表示为“1”都可因人而设。如果设定高电平为“1”低电平为“0”则叫正逻辑,如果反过来,设定低电平为“1”高电平为“0”的时候,则为负逻辑。一般情况下,没有加以特殊说明,我们均采用正逻辑关系。
在实际电路中,高电平是几伏,低电平是几伏。没有严格的规定,例如在TTL电路中,高电平为3V左右,低电平为0.5V左右,而在CMOS电路中,高电平为3~18V或者7~15V,低电平为0V。(技成原创,未经授权不得转载,违者必究!)
往期优秀文章回顾:
S7-200SMART PLC重点精讲:模拟量模块接线图、扩展模块、CPU结构
什么是脉冲?脉冲在PLC当中有什么作用?
在接触PLC的过程当中,我们时常会碰到三种变量,分别是开关量,模拟量和脉冲量。
前面两天我们已经分享过,关于开关量和模拟量的一些内容需要详细了解的朋友可以查看下面链接。什么是PLC的开关量?什么是PLC中的模拟量?
脉冲
接下来,我们就详细的讲一下,什么是脉冲。
书面官方的说法是极短时间,电压和电流信号,我们把它叫做脉冲信号。
用大白话来讲的话就是电的冲击信号一通一断,我们把它叫做一个脉冲。
脉冲这个量,在PLC的应用过程当中非常广泛,作用也非常的大,但是呢,这个词比较抽象,很多人不能够轻易的搞明白。
我们举一个简单的例子,我们每个人在手上都有脉搏,其实这个脉搏,他就是一个脉冲,只不过它不是一个电信号,他是一个血流过来的冲击信号,但是他和我们说的脉冲的意义是一样的。
我们的脉搏每跳动一次,我们认为就是说出了一个脉冲,我们的脉搏连续跳动,形成了一个一个的脉冲串,
那么我们的医生,就是通过我们这个脉冲串的强弱和每秒钟或者是每分钟多少次?来判断这个人的身体状况。
把脉
然后可能你的脑海里会浮现起一个须发皆白的老中医,用手搭在患者的手腕上,另一只手捋着白色的胡须,眼睛目视前方,若有所思,片刻之后。便开出一方,你吃了药到病除!
PLC的应用过程当中,同样有类似的场景,那就是外部的旋转编码器给出信号来到PLC,PLC通过运算,实现了很多的精确控制,比如说角度定位,长度定位等等。
旋转编码器
刚才提到的旋转编码器就是发送脉冲的一个器件,在后面的过程当中,我们会给大家详细讲解旋转编码器的。
在上面的应用当中,PLC就相当于是那个老中医啦,它通过感知编码器发过来的脉冲,作出正确的判断,然后给到执行元件一些合理的信号,完成生产所需。
那脉冲的模样到底是什么样子的呢?大家看看下面这个图,
各种脉冲
大部分的PLC都有脉冲输出功能,利用这个脉冲输出功能呢,可以控制步进电机,也可以控制伺服电机,这部分的内容我们放在下一次来分享,因为内容比较多,相对比较复杂。
步进电机
总结一下,所谓的脉冲,就是把电开一下就关掉,开一下就关掉,就形成了脉冲。
大家搞清楚了吗?
相关问答
plc高速脉冲有什么用?
PLC内部有两个高速脉冲发生器,通过设置可让它们产生占空比为50%、周期可调的方波脉冲(即PTO脉冲),或者产生占空比及周期均可调节的脉宽调制脉冲(即PWM脉冲)...
plc脉冲输入是什么?
plc脉冲输入有很多种。一种是指令中的单个脉冲输出,比如上升沿脉冲指令LDP,或者PLS,是当位元件(比如X0,M0等)由OFF变成ON时发出一个扫描周期的脉冲;下降...p...
PLC编程脉冲是什么意思?又有什么意思?
在PLC(可编程逻辑控制器)编程中,"脉冲"通常指的是输入或输出信号中的脉冲信号。它表示一个短暂的电信号脉冲,通常用于传输信息或触发某些动作。脉冲信号在PLC...
plc一般脉冲是接哪里?
plc脉冲一般接输出线,采用专用端钮接线盒。安装及使用电度表在出厂前经检验合格,并加封铅印,可安装使用。如果无铅封或贮存时间过久的电度表应请有关部门重校...
plc输出脉冲和方向怎么定义?
PLC输出脉冲和方向的定义需要通过程序编写来实现。首先,需要定义PLC输出口的类型,如是否为数字输出口或模拟输出口。然后,需要在程序中定义输出脉冲的频率和...
plc脉冲输出原理?
PLC是采用“顺序扫描,不断循环”的方式进行工作的。即在PLC运行时,CPU根据用户按控制要求编制好并存于用户存储器中的程序,按指令步序号(或地址号)作周期性...
步进电机控制,PLC为什么要有高速脉冲输出功能?
PLC对步进电机也具有良好的控制能力,利用其高速脉冲输出功能或运动控制功能,即可实现对步进电机的控制。步进电机是一种低转子惯量、高定位精度、小误差、控...
plc程序如何产生脉冲-皇室米澜的回答-懂得
PLS与PLF是上升沿与下降沿检测指令,不能用于脉冲输出。三菱PLC用于脉冲输出的指令应用指令里的FNC55--FNC59。一般用PLSY指令输出,还需设置一些...
如何让PLC一直输出脉冲?
我来回答这个问题,让PLC输出脉冲的方法还是比较多的,我们可以根据控制不同的负载,通过不同的指令输出脉冲的频率是不一样的。下面我们以日系PLC(可编程控制器...
plc程序如何产生脉冲-130****6680的回答-懂得
plc中有脉冲输出的指令,然后接个通电延时指令就可以了,可以试试下面是产生1秒的脉冲信号的方法:方法1:采用硬件组态中CPU属性下的MemoryClock,这...
扫一扫微信交流